Sheffield Wednesday defender Jack Hunt has paid tribute to striker Lee Gregory while celebrating his side’s 3-2 win over Fleetwood Town on Tuesday night.

Things started well for the Owls in that match, with Gregory firing them ahead inside the opening five minutes.

However, goals from Callum Camps and Joe Garner would turn things around to give Fleetwood a 2-1 lead at half time.

But Gregory was not done yet, and Wednesday’s top scorer would come up with two goals in just 46 seconds half an hour into the second half, to complete his hat-trick, and earn his side a vital 3-2 win in the battle for a League One play-off place.

That results means that Wednesday are fourth in the League One table, two points clear of seventh place Wycombe, meaning they go into their final day clash with Portsmouth at Hillsborough on Saturday, with a play-off spot in their own hands.

Perhaps not surprisingly therefore, Hunt was in a buoyant mood as he took to his Instagram page to react to that win, writing: “AbsoluteLEE fantastic ⚽️⚽️⚽️🤩 big win and 1 more back home we go 🦉”.

The Verdict

What a signing Gregory has been for Wednesday this season, and what a result this was for Wednesday.

That’s now 15 goals in an Owls shirt for Gregory in the league this season, which is at least six more than any other player.

It is clear therefore, just how important he has been to them since joining in the summer, especially when he is making contributions such as this, that turn no points, into three points.

As a result, Wednesday are now in a strong position to secure a top six place heading into the final day, which would give them a shot at an immediate promotion back to the Championship, a remarkable achievement given the state the club was in when they were relegated at the end of last season.
